This paper analyzes stability and convergence properties of a conjugate heat transfer problem in one space dimension. The energy method is used to derive boundary and interface conditions and to prove that the semi-discrete problem is stable. The numerical scheme is implemented using 2nd-, 3rdand 4th-order finite difference operators on Summation-By-Parts (SBP) form. The boundary and interface conditions are implemented weakly using the Simultaneous Approximation Term (SAT).
